Caused by: java.sql.SQLException: No suitable driver found for http://maven.apache.org
时间: 2024-06-13 17:09:18 浏览: 192
服务器出现java.sql.SQLException No suitable driver found for 的.pdf
这个异常的原因是JDBC无法找到适合的驱动程序来连接到指定的URL。这通常是由于以下原因之一引起的:
1. 没有将正确的JDBC驱动程序添加到类路径中。
2. JDBC URL格式不正确。
3. JDBC驱动程序版本与数据库版本不兼容。
解决方案:
1. 确保已将正确的JDBC驱动程序添加到类路径中。可以从官方网站下载适合您的数据库版本的JDBC驱动程序,并将其添加到类路径中。
2. 检查JDBC URL格式是否正确。确保它以正确的协议开头(例如jdbc:mysql://)并且没有任何拼写错误。
3. 确保JDBC驱动程序版本与数据库版本兼容。如果您使用的是较旧的数据库版本,则需要使用相应版本的JDBC驱动程序。
示例代码:
```java
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;
public class TestJDBC {
public static void main(String[] args) {
Connection conn = null;
try {
Class.forName("com.mysql.jdbc.Driver");
String url = "jdbc:mysql://localhost:3306/test";
String user = "root";
String password = "123456";
conn = DriverManager.getConnection(url, user, password);
System.out.println("Connection Successful!");
} catch (ClassNotFoundException e) {
e.printStackTrace();
} catch (SQLException e) {
e.printStackTrace();
} finally {
try {
if (conn != null) {
conn.close();
}
} catch (SQLException e) {
e.printStackTrace();
}
}
}
}
```
阅读全文